Hi Naomi,
IÂ looked in Classification Web under G9900 and here is what it says:
G9900Â Â Theoretical maps.
               “Class here maps whose primary intent is the illustration or definition of terms and concepts and maps designed to illustrate methods of map making. Class maps of a determinable geographic area with the area.â€
It does not reference a table of any kind.
Sorry I can’t be of further help L

I am cataloging several theoretical maps, with no specific geographic location. At the end of the G schedule is G9900-G9980 for ‘Unlocalized maps’ with G9900 for ‘Theoretical maps’. By looking at similar type records in OCLC it looks like Table G1 has been applied leading to classification G9901 followed by a subject number. This appears logical and useful but using online Classification Web I cannot see the instruction to use a table. Please can someone advise on current practice?
